Welcome to Lowthwaite B&B Watermillock, a beautiful house on the northern edge of the Lake District, boasting a range of architectural styles and stunning views. The property offers a tranquil haven in the Eden Valley, with easy access to all rooms due to the house being on the fellside. At just 55 km away from Carlisle Lake District, Lowthwaite B&B is ideally located for exploring the surrounding areas.
The B&B's location offers a variety of activities and picturesque walks, such as the 7.8-mile walk around Gowbarrow with stunning views over Ullswater and waterfalls, or the popular Helvellyn Mountain walk. Moreover, the Lakeland Trails bring some of the most inspiring trail running events in the UK, all held within the Lake District National Park. With its perfect balance of comfort, charm, and adventure, Lowthwaite B&B Watermillock is the ideal destination to experience the best of the Lake District's offerings.
The Helvellyn, Matterdale, and Blencathra rooms feature a big terrace close to the fellside on several levels. With wooden chairs and tables, they all share a lovely trickling stream at the bottom, offering a serene atmosphere. The Blencathra and Garden bathrooms have nice wooden floors salvaged from the living room floorboards in the old farmhouse, adding a touch of history and charm.
Dining at the Lowthwaite B&B Watermillock is a treat for the palate, offering two options for every meal: a Basic one, providing enough for a light lunch, or a Full one that can sustain you throughout the day. Breakfast is an exceptional experience, featuring healthy cereals, fresh fruit, homemade breads, and delightful muffins. The property also houses an 18th-century pub cum restaurant, tastefully refurbished with a real pub feel and serving locally-sourced produce.
Services offered at Lowthwaite B&B include helpful staff who can provide you with information and recommendations for local attractions, such as the nearby Acorn Bank, a tranquil Eden Valley oasis famous for its daffodil display and woodland walks. Electric bikes can be hired at Arragons in Penrith, which is an interesting option for exploring the area.
